  • National Museum is also known as National Museum of India located at Rajpath Crossing Janpath, New Delhi. It was first established in 1949 at Rashtrapati Bhavan and inaugurated on 15th August 1949. The foundation stone of the current building was laid on 12 May 1955 by Prime minister Jwahar Lal Nehru and first was completed and opened for public on 18 December 1960.
